The increasing development of industry across various sectors is inextricably linked to the importance of Occupational Health and Safety (OHS) aspects. Negligence in Occupational Health and Safety (OHS) can lead to workplace accidents that impact not only the individual but also others. The trend of workplace accidents reflects the failure to implement OHS procedures and a lack of awareness regarding rights, obligations, and fairness in the workplace. This study aims to analyze the role of Pancasila as the legal basis for fulfilling worker’s Occupational Health and Safety (OHS) rights through a literature approach. The method used is analytical and normative library research, examining various relevant scientific sources such as journals, publications, official documents, and laws and regulations that discuss the role of Pancasila, Occupational Health and Safety (OHS), and occupational accident insurance. The results of this study indicate that Pancasila serves as the legal basis for laws and regulations related to the implementation of Occupational Health and Safety (OHS). These laws and regulations aim to uphold worker’s dignity and create fairness in the workplace. Implementing Pancasila values in every Occupational Health and Safety (OHS) policy and program is a concrete way of creating a safe, healthy, fair, humane, and participatory work environment that protects worker’s dignity. Furthermore, the implementation of an occupational accident insurance program is one of the responsibilities and obligations of workplace owners and the government to provide socio-economic protection to workers.
